ORF, the national host broadcaster and host broadcaster for the forthcoming 2015 Eurovision Song Contest has launched a special Eurovision website in German.

ORF’s official Eurovision website is in German and contains various features: news ,volunteers, social media, and artists. The website will be populated with more features, news and snippets leading up to the 2015 Eurovision Song Contest in Vienna. The countdown to the 2015 Eurovision Song Contest has kicked off as thousands of Eurovision fans will be landing in the majestic Austrian capital next May, around 1700 accredited journalists and delegations from 39  countries. Preparations are already in full swing in Austria as ORF, the 2015 Eurovision host broadcaster is working round the clock in order to showcase an extraordinary and entertaining show.

The 2015 Eurovision Song Contest is scheduled to be held on 19, 21, and 23 May at the Wiener Stadthalle in Vienna, Austria.
